Molotra is a genus of spiders in the family Oonopidae. It was first described in 2011 by Ubick & Griswold. , it contains 6 species, all from Madagascar.
==Species== Molotra comprises the following species: Molotra katarinae Ubick & Griswold, 2011 Molotra milloti Ubick & Griswold, 2011 Molotra molotra Ubick & Griswold, 2011 Molotra ninae Ubick & Griswold, 2011 Molotra suzannae Ubick & Griswold, 2011 Molotra tsingy Ubick & Griswold, 2011
